QUOTE(wyyew @ Oct 5 2017, 01:29 PM) I wonder whether maxis allow to port it to prepaid plan , as I am still using the old plan only 3gb principle with 2 subline total RM170+ ...Sometimes, I do need to buy RM8 for day pass. That's not port in or port out. That's called changing your Maxis postpaid service to prepaid service (Hotlink) and the procedure is so much easier. You don't need to wait for any port out confirmation SMS or to reply any SMS. And to change from postpaid service to prepaid service and vice-versa within Maxis takes very little time. On a working day, this can be done in under 1 hour. Sometimes it takes longer depending on how efficient the particular Maxis Centre is. On a weekend, sometimes it takes around 4 hours. You may change from Maxis postpaid to Hotlink anytime as long as your number isn't tied to any contract.
